Aborígena, located in the sun-drenched region of Malaga, Spain, offers a unique approach to personal transformation. This isn't your typical meditation retreat; instead, it focuses on a dynamic blend of movement, breath, sound, nature, and community to foster growth. Imagine starting your day with yoga or breathwork, then diving into something as expressive as dance therapy or ecstatic dance, perhaps even exploring animal flow. The center also incorporates sound healing, traditional cacao rituals, and kirtan, ensuring a diverse and engaging program. With conscious full-board nutrition, including vegetarian, vegan, and gluten-free options, Aborígena provides a holistic environment for exploration and self-discovery. It's an ideal spot for those looking to connect with themselves and others through a rich tapestry of practices.

Setting
Situated in the beautiful Finca Arrijana in Sayalonga, Malaga, the center is surrounded by the natural beauty of the Spanish countryside. While specific details about the immediate landscape aren't provided, the region is known for its pleasant climate and scenic views, offering a serene backdrop for retreat activities.

Climate
Malaga enjoys a Mediterranean climate, characterized by hot, dry summers and mild winters. Spring and autumn are generally pleasant, making them ideal times for a retreat, though the A/C in rooms ensures comfort year-round.

Frequently asked questions
What kind of activities can I expect at Aborígena?
Aborígena offers a wide array of activities including yoga, breathwork, kundalini, dance therapy, ecstatic dance, animal flow, sound healing, cacao rituals, kirtan, and dedicated integration spaces.
Are there options for specific dietary needs?
Yes, Aborígena provides conscious full-board nutrition with balanced, natural meals. Vegetarian, vegan, and gluten-free adaptations are available upon request.
What amenities are available at the center?
The center offers A/C in rooms, free Wifi, a pool, towels, free parking, a kitchen, coffee/tea facilities, a cafe, and a yoga studio.
